Atsushi Koga
kog****@ceres*****
2005年 6月 9日 (木) 01:57:37 JST
kog と申します。 subversion の win32対応を改善してみました。 HEADのおっかけをやっているので取り込みを検討していただけると 幸いです。 LINUXでのテストは残念ながらできてません。 変更点 * svnはNT系のwin32のみ対応しているようなので、cmd.exe前提。 * HikiFarmのリポジトリがローカルかどうかのチェックを厳しく * svnのコマンドラインをメソッドに切り出し。 * win32だと判定したら、コマンドラインを上書きする。 判定は repos_root が [A-z]: で始まるかどうか。 したがって、@repos_root は c:/home/foo/src/svn とか書く。 * mingw32で使うと、localtime.to_sが漢字交じりになるので化ける対応 環境 * Hiki with HikiFarm(CVS HEAD) * ruby 1.8.2 (2004-12-25) [i386-mingw32] * Server version: Apache/1.3.31 (Win32) Server built: May 11 2004 10:03:33 * svn, version 1.1.3 (r12730) compiled Jan 20 2005, 05:51:34 * WindowsXPsp2 ps. cvs diff -N -u -r HEAD したんですが、追加ファイルは認識されない ように見えますが、もしかして方法ありますか? 以上 -------------- next part -------------- テキスト形式以外の添付ファイルを保管しました... ファイル名: win32svn.patch 型: application/octet-stream サイズ: 7846 バイト 説明: 無し Download -------------- next part -------------- テキスト形式以外の添付ファイルを保管しました... ファイル名: win32svn.rb 型: application/octet-stream サイズ: 1200 バイト 説明: 無し URL: http://lists.sourceforge.jp/mailman/archives/hiki-dev/attachments/20050609/91dd4c05/attachment-0001.obj